The Honest Truth: Instant Shaping vs. Permanent Change

Before the how-to, here's the line every honest brand should draw clearly.

Shaping garments — waist trainers, body shapers, and compression shapewear — work by gently redistributing soft tissue and providing firm, structured support around your midsection. The result is an immediate, visible hourglass shape. But that effect lasts only while you're wearing the garment. As soon as you take it off, your body returns to its natural shape.

These garments do not melt fat, do not "train" your ribs permanently, and are not a weight-loss tool. Anyone promising permanent body change from a garment alone is overselling. What they genuinely offer is real, reliable, on-demand shaping — and there's nothing wrong with loving how you look in them.

Think of it the way you'd think of a great pair of heels or a tailored blazer: a styling tool that enhances your shape for the moment, on your terms.

Method 2: Posture — The Free Hourglass Upgrade

Posture is the most underrated curve enhancer, and it costs nothing.

When you stand tall — shoulders back and relaxed, chest open, core gently engaged — your waist naturally appears more defined and your whole frame looks more balanced. Slouching, by contrast, compresses your midsection and flattens your silhouette. Many people find that a waist trainer's structured support is a helpful reminder to sit and stand taller during wear.

Practicing better posture throughout the day is one of the simplest, most sustainable ways to look more poised and curvy, no garment required.

Method 3: Styling for Proportion and Balance

Clothing is an illusionist's toolkit. The right styling choices can emphasize your waist and create hourglass balance:

  • Define the waist. Belts, wrap dresses, peplum tops, and fitted-then-flared shapes draw the eye to your narrowest point.
  • Balance top and bottom. Pairing a fuller skirt or wide-leg trouser with a fitted top (or vice versa) creates the visual contrast that reads as curvy.
  • Use vertical lines and structure. Tailoring, darts, and seams that nip in at the waist do a lot of quiet work.
  • Choose the right neckline. V-necks and scoop necks elongate and balance your upper half.

Styling works with whatever shape you have — and it stacks beautifully on top of shapewear for an even more defined look.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can you really get an hourglass figure without surgery?

Yes — you can create a clearly defined hourglass silhouette without surgery using shapewear and waist trainers for instant shaping, plus posture and styling. The effect from garments is temporary and lasts while you wear them, but it's real, immediate, and adjustable.

Do waist trainers permanently change your body?

No. Waist trainers and shapewear provide a temporary, reversible shaping effect. Your body returns to its natural shape once you take the garment off. They are not a weight-loss or fat-reduction tool, and any claim of permanent body change from a garment alone is misleading.

How tight should a waist trainer be?

Snug and supportive, never painful. You should be able to breathe comfortably and move with ease. If a waist trainer restricts your breathing or causes discomfort, size up and follow the brand's size guide closely, since sizing varies between brands.

How long can I wear a waist trainer?

Start with shorter sessions and listen to your body, gradually extending wear time only as far as stays comfortable. Comfort is the limit — never push through pain. If you have any health concerns, check with a doctor before regular wear.

What's the difference between a waist trainer and a body shaper?

A waist trainer focuses firm, structured compression on the midsection for a cinched waist. A body shaper smooths a larger area — tummy, hips, and back — for a seamless head-to-toe silhouette under clothing. Many people own both for different outfits and occasions.
